Dance can be a ritual, an art, or just fun and recreation. This rhythmic and patterned movement to music (and without music) tells a story, expresses emotions and ideas, serves religious and social needs, and entertains. Your student can complete a lapbook on the story of dance with the 63-page Let’s Dance! A Study in Dance Styles Project Pack from In the Hands of a Child.
The 11-page Research Guide includes kinds and purpose of dance, dance styles, history of dancing, careers in dance, and famous dancers. To create a dance lapbook, your complete 21 hands-on activities that correlate to the information learned in the Research Guide. Let’s Dance!
